According to two people familiar with the mater, Morgan Stanely may pay between $2 to $3 billion for a controlling stake in Citigroup's Smith Barney retail brokerage business. The cash would help out Citigroup, who is coming under mounting pressure to clean up its balance sheet after borrowing $45 billion from the government last year.

Morgan Stanley announced plans to cut its staff by 10 percent in order to cope with deteriorating economic conditions. Morgan Stanley currently employees 46,383 people.

Morgan Stanley, the second largest securities firm, announced Wednesday plans to eliminate 1,000 positions. The company is drastically reducing its U.S. mortgage business and also shutting down its home loans division in the U.K.

A state controlled China Investment Corp. acquired roughly 9.9% of Morgan Stanley for $5 billion in cash. The news comes after Morgan Stanley reported its first quarter loss Wednesday. It posted a huge loss of $3.54 billion or $3.61 per share. CEO, John Mack, stated that the loss was `embarrassing` and that he would forgo his bonus for the year.

Morgan Stanley issued a warning today warning of a steep slowdown in business investment and conditions that could lead to a full blown recession in 2008. In a report entitled "Recession Coming," Morgan Stanley reported that the credit crunch has started to cause serious damage to US companies.

Morgan Stanley posted Q3 earnings of $1.47 billion or $1.44 per share compared to $1.75 per share last year. This represents a 17 percent drop in profits primary due to writing down almost $1 billion dollars worth of loans amongst this years credit crisis.
